Proverbs 1:1) The proverbs of Solomon the son of David, king of Israel;
2 .) To know wisdom and instruction; to perceive the words of understanding;
3 .) To receive the instruction of wisdom, justice, and judgment, and equity;
4 .) To give subtilty to the simple, to the young man knowledge and discretion.
5 .) A wise man will hear, and will increase learning; and a man of understanding shall attain unto wise counsels:
6 .) To understand a proverb, and the interpretation; the words of the wise, and their dark sayings.
7 .) The fear of the LORD is the beginning of knowledge: but fools despise wisdom and instruction.

[h=1]Ecclesiastes
3[/h]
1 .) To every thing there is a season, and a time to every purpose under the heaven:
2 .) A time to be born, and a time to die; a time to plant, and a time to pluck up that which is planted;
3 .) A time to kill, and a time to heal; a time to break down, and a time to build up;
4 .) A time to weep, and a time to laugh; a time to mourn, and a time to dance;
5 .) A time to cast away stones, and a time to gather stones together; a time to embrace, and a time to refrain from embracing;
6 .) A time to get, and a time to lose; a time to keep, and a time to cast away;
7 .) A time to rend, and a time to sew; a time to keep silence, and a time to speak;
8 .) A time to love, and a time to hate; a time of war, and a time of peace.

[h=1]1 Corinthians
15[/h]
1 .) Moreover, brethren, I declare unto you the gospel which I preached unto you, which also ye have received, and wherein ye stand;
2 .) By which also ye are saved, if ye keep in memory what I preached unto you, unless ye have believed in vain.
3 .) For I delivered unto you first of all that which I also received, how that Christ died for our sins according to the scriptures;
4 .) And that he was buried, and that he rose again the third day according to the scriptures:
5 .) And that he was seen of Cephas, then of the twelve:
6 .) After that, he was seen of above five hundred brethren at once; of whom the greater part remain unto this present, but some are fallen asleep.
7 .) After that, he was seen of James; then of all the apostles.
8 .) And last of all he was seen of me also, as of one born out of due time.
9 .) For I am the least of the apostles, that am not meet to be called an apostle, because I persecuted the church of God.
10 .) But by the grace of God I am what I am: and his grace which was bestowed upon me was not in vain; but I laboured more abundantly than they all: yet not I, but the grace of God which was with me.
11 .) Therefore whether it were I or they, so we preach, and so ye believed.
12 .) Now if Christ be preached that he rose from the dead, how say some among you that there is no resurrection of the dead?
13 .) But if there be no resurrection of the dead, then is Christ not risen:
14 .) And if Christ be not risen, then is our preaching vain, and your faith is also vain.
